| Features | Frequency: 2.400-2.4835GHz
Wireless Security: Support 64/128 bit WEP, WPA-PSK/WPA2-PSK, Wireless MAC Filtering
Antenna Type: Omni directional, Detachable, Reverse SMA
Antenna Gain: 2 x 3dBi
External Power Supply: 12VDC/1.5A
Button: 1 Power On/Off Button 1 WPS Button 1 Wi-Fi On/Off Button 1 RESET Button
ADSL Standards: Full-rate ANSI T1.413 Issue 2 ITU-T G.992.1(G.DMT) ITU-T G.992.2(G.Lite) ITU-T G.994.1 (G.hs) ITU-T G.995.1
ADSL2 Standards: ITU-T G.992.3 (G.dmt.bis) ITU-T G.992.4 (G.lite.bis)
ADSL2+ Standards: ITU-T G.992.5
Quality of Service: Bandwidth Control
Port Forwarding: Virtual server, DMZ, ACL(Access Control List)
VPN Pass-Through: PPTP, L2TP, IPSec Pass-through
ATM/PPP Protocols: ATM Forum UNI3.1/4.0 PPP over ATM (RFC 2364) PPP over Ethernet (RFC2516) IPoA (RFC1577/2225) PVC - Up to 8 PVCs
Security: NAT Firewall, SPI Firewall, MAC / IP / Packet / URL Filtering
System Requirements: Microsoft Windows 98SE, NT, 2000, XP, Vista or Windows 7, MAC OS, NetWare, UNIX or Linux.
All-in-One Device: ADSL Modem, NAT Router, Switch and Wireless N Access Point
2.4GHz, IEEE802.11b/g/n, up to 300Mbps data transfer rates
USB Port for Storage Sharing, Printer Sharing, FTP Server and Media Server
Ethernet WAN (EWAN) offers another broadband connectivity option for connecting to Cable, VDSL or Fiber modems
IP QoS features for improved bandwidth control across the network. |
